Linux服务器硬盘扩容问题

现情况:服务器上只有一个硬盘,安装系统的时候空间划分没有规划好;给了500G给根目录,只有60G给了home目录,现在加装一个15T的硬盘。
问:
1、请问是否可以将15T的硬盘将其划分,10T给home目录,5T给根目录?
2、如果第一个问题实现不了,那是否可以将一整个15T扩容给home目录?
问题的主要目的就是“硬盘扩容

如果从一开头就没有做LVM的话,那就别想了,扩容不了。
所以,从学习的那刻起,就要好好学习,有经验的讲师,都会告知你LVM的重要性,尤其是要自己管理的机器,除非,搞云,云另说。
否则都需要做好规划。


所以第一问,不能。
第二问,这个就需要你核查你现在所有/home 目录下的用户和相关数据,万一挂载过去,而原来的数据和系统设置没做好迁移的话,就会出现问题。
其实,为啥不挂载去一个叫/data的盘,把应用都迁移到过那边呢???数据也迁移过去呢???

是的,你可以将 15T 硬盘划分成多个分区,其中一个分区扩展 home 目录,另一个分区扩展根目录。

要执行此操作,你需要使用分区工具,比如 fdisk 或 gparted。首先,你需要在新硬盘上创建一个或多个分区。然后,你需要使用挂载命令将这些分区挂载到指定的目录。

例如,假设你已经在新硬盘上创建了一个分区,并将其标记为 /dev/sdb1。你可以使用以下命令将其挂载到 home 目录:

sudo mkdir /mnt/home
sudo mount /dev/sdb1 /mnt/home

然后,你可以使用以下命令将 home 目录的内容移动到新的分区:

sudo rsync -avx /home/. /mnt/home/.

最后,你可以修改 /etc/fstab 文件,使新分区在每次启动时自动挂载到 home 目录。

注意:在执行这些操作之前,你应该先备份重要的文件,以防出现意外情况。